I know gramlight fd suggested that JKL is making these parts but I don't think so..

Like I stated earlier, I found a chinese source that replicates bunch of import car parts (MS, Honda, Bride seats, RE-a,etc) and all the parts JKL used to sell IS on there. I wanted to find more about the products and I chatted with the rep via email and he specifically told me that they have the mold and ARE made in china.

SO, JKL i think was just a middle man and NOT actual manufacturer of these parts.

Just wanted to clarify my findings to you guys..

I was impatient and bought a knock off kit a few moths back. After trying to find one states side and getting the runnaround I got one from a company in England had it in less than two weeks. Front 05 ,with undertray ,carbon canards, front fenders with carbon add on, sides ,and rear quarters. And a big carbon wing. Rear add ons fit terrible and sides didn't fit to suit me either. But for the price I can defiantly work it out. Bottom line I would of without a doubt bought one from ken if it had all ready been produced.
